Getting from Las Americas International Airport (SDQ) to central Santo Domingo
From Las Americas International Airport, Santo Domingo is approximately 32 kilometres away. It takes around 30 minutes to get to the centre driving.
When to fly to Las Americas International Airport (SDQ)
It's time to work out your trip dates for your flight from Lambert-St. Louis International Airport to Las Americas International Airport. January is the busiest month to head to Santo Domingo. If you prefer a more relaxed vibe, go in May.
The warmest month in Santo Domingo is September, with the temperature ranging between 23ºC (73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F). Lock in your flights from Lambert-St. Louis International Airport to Las Americas International Airport in this month if this is the kind of weather you like.
Search for cheap tickets from STL to SDQ in February if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 19ºC (66ºF) and 29ºC (84ºF) on average.
